The Scope of work includes the replacement of existing lead. lead-lined, and galvanized water services with new polyethylene of copper water service lines, inclusive of the water main tap, service saddle (if required), service tubing, curb stop and box, and conneection to the customer's inside service line. If both the inside and outside service lines are found to be composed of lead, lead-lined, or galvanized material, the service line shall be replaced from the water main to the meter. A full service line flush from the water main to the meter is required following the service installation. The work includes surface restoration of disturbed areas. This project includes new DBE and Workforce Goals (reference Section SLR-19 and SLR 20), and the requirements of the NYS Drinking Water State Revolving Fund, (Mandatory State Revolving Fund Terms and Condition dated October 1, 2025) apply.
